    Substance of proposed rule:
    The Public Service Commission is considering whether to adopt, modify or reject a petition filed by Niagara Mohawk Power Corporation d/b/a National Grid requesting approval of a new gas Economic Development Program. The request was filed as part of the utility’s Economic Development Grant Programs Annual Report on October 1, 2014. The proposed program would be a gas version of the existing electric Manufacturing Productivity Program which provides matching grants for productivity assistance and growth projects designed to use excess capacity. The Commission may adopt, reject or modify the petition and address any related matters.
